The circadian rhythm, also known as the body's internal clock, plays a significant role in regulating sleep-wake patterns, and melatonin supplements in gummy form can help align this rhythm with an individual's desired sleep schedule. Maintaining a consistent sleep schedule is a fundamental aspect of good sleep hygiene, and melatonin gummies can complement these efforts by assisting in falling asleep faster and maintaining a more regular sleep-wake cycle.
